首页 / 日本VPS推荐 / 正文
如何高效搭建CDN节点提升网站性能与用户体验的终极指南

Time:2025年04月03日 Read:3 评论:0 作者:y21dr45

在当今互联网时代,网站的性能和用户体验至关重要。无论是电商平台、新闻门户还是个人博客,快速加载速度和稳定的访问体验都是吸引和留住用户的关键。而内容分发网络(CDN)作为提升网站性能的核心技术之一,其重要性不言而喻。本文将深入探讨如何高效搭建CDN节点,帮助您优化网站性能,提升用户体验。

如何高效搭建CDN节点提升网站性能与用户体验的终极指南

一、什么是CDN?

CDN(Content Delivery Network,内容分发网络)是一种分布式网络架构,通过在全球多个地理位置部署服务器节点,将网站内容缓存并分发到离用户最近的节点上,从而减少数据传输距离和延迟,提升访问速度。简单来说,CDN就像是一个遍布全球的“快递网络”,能够将您的网站内容快速送达用户手中。

二、为什么需要搭建CDN节点?

1. 提升访问速度:通过将内容缓存到离用户最近的节点上,CDN可以显著减少数据传输时间,提升页面加载速度。

2. 减轻源服务器负载:CDN节点可以分担源服务器的流量压力,避免因高并发访问导致的服务器崩溃。

3. 提高稳定性:多节点部署可以有效避免单点故障,确保网站在不同地区的稳定访问。

4. 优化SEO排名:页面加载速度是搜索引擎排名的重要因素之一,使用CDN可以提升网站的SEO表现。

三、如何搭建CDN节点?

1. 确定需求与目标

在搭建CDN节点之前,首先需要明确您的需求和目标。例如:

- 目标用户分布:您的用户主要分布在哪些地区?

- 流量规模:预计的日均访问量和峰值流量是多少?

- 内容类型:主要分发的是静态内容(如图片、CSS、JS文件)还是动态内容(如API接口)?

- 预算与成本:您愿意为CDN服务投入多少资金?

2. 选择合适的CDN服务商

市面上有许多知名的CDN服务商可供选择,如阿里云、腾讯云、Cloudflare、Akamai等。选择时需要考虑以下因素:

- 覆盖范围:服务商的节点是否覆盖您的目标用户地区?

- 性能表现:节点的响应速度和稳定性如何?

- 技术支持:是否提供24/7的技术支持服务?

- 价格与计费方式:是否符合您的预算?是否有灵活的计费方式?

3. 配置源服务器

在搭建CDN节点之前,需要对源服务器进行必要的配置:

- 启用缓存:确保源服务器支持HTTP缓存头(如Cache-Control、Expires),以便CDN节点能够正确缓存内容。

- 优化内容:对静态资源进行压缩和合并,减少文件大小和请求次数。

- 安全设置:配置SSL证书,确保数据传输的安全性。

4. 部署与配置CDN节点

根据选择的CDN服务商提供的文档和工具,进行节点的部署与配置:

- 添加域名:将您的网站域名添加到CDN服务商的控制面板中。

- 配置CNAME记录:在DNS管理面板中为您的域名添加CNAME记录,指向CDN服务商提供的域名。

- 设置缓存规则:根据内容类型和更新频率,设置合理的缓存规则。例如,静态资源可以设置较长的缓存时间,而动态内容则需要较短的缓存时间或实时更新。

- 启用HTTPS:确保所有节点的通信都通过HTTPS加密传输。

5. 测试与优化

完成部署后,需要进行全面的测试与优化:

- 性能测试:使用工具如Google PageSpeed Insights、Pingdom等测试网站的加载速度和性能表现。

- 监控与分析:利用CDN服务商提供的监控工具或第三方分析工具(如Google Analytics),实时监控节点的运行状态和流量情况。

- 持续优化:根据监控数据和用户反馈,不断调整缓存规则、优化内容和扩展节点。

四、常见问题与解决方案

1. 缓存不一致问题

- *问题描述*:用户在访问不同节点时看到的内容不一致。

- *解决方案*:检查源服务器的缓存头设置是否正确;确保所有节点的缓存规则一致;定期清理或刷新缓存。

2. HTTPS证书问题

- *问题描述*:部分用户在访问时遇到证书错误或无法建立安全连接。

- *解决方案*:确保证书在所有节点上正确安装;检查CNAME记录是否正确指向HTTPS域名;使用统一的SSL证书管理工具。

3. 高延迟问题

- *问题描述*:某些地区的用户访问速度较慢。

- *解决方案*:增加该地区的节点数量;优化路由策略;使用智能DNS解析服务。

五、实用建议

1. 多备份策略

为了应对突发情况(如某个节点宕机),建议在不同地区部署多个备用节点。这样即使某个节点出现问题,其他节点仍能正常提供服务。

2. 智能路由

利用智能路由技术(如Anycast),根据用户的实时网络状况动态选择最优路径。这不仅可以提升访问速度还能有效降低延迟。

3. 定期维护

定期对各个节点的硬件设备进行检查和维护确保其处于最佳工作状态同时及时更新软件版本修复已知漏洞提高安全性。

4. “冷热”数据分离

对于频繁更新的“热”数据采用较短甚至不缓存的策略而对于不常变动的“冷”数据则采用较长甚至永久性缓存的策略以此达到最佳效果平衡点既保证了数据新鲜度又提高了整体效率降低了成本支出压力!

5 . “灰度发布”机制

在新增或者修改某些重要功能时候可以采用“灰度发布”机制先小范围内部测试再逐步扩大范围最终全面上线这样可以有效避免大规模故障发生保障业务连续性稳定性!

6 . “日志分析”

通过对各个节点的日志进行深入分析可以发现潜在的问题隐患及时采取相应措施进行预防和处理同时也可以为后续的决策提供有力依据支持!

六、总结

搭建高效的 CD N节

TAG:搭建cdn节点,cdn节点接入,搭建CDN节点需要投入多少资金,搭建cdn要怎么配置,cdn节点是什么概念

标签:
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1